Editing attribution

Found online: “He was never as good as everybody said he was,” the former quarterback Trent Dilfer, now an ESPN analyst, said Monday.

I don't like splitting up attribution. This would read better as “He was never as good as everybody said he was,” said Trent Dilfer, a former quarterback and now an ESPN analyst. I took Monday 
out; it's not necessary.
